Bilim Akademisi Report on Academic Freedoms 2020-2021 (Summary)

The Science Academy has been publishing reports on academic freedom since the year 2015, summarizing the developments and sharing them with the public. The report we have drafted this year is once more a compendium of outstanding violations of academic freedoms in our country. Most of the violations stem from the authority accorded to the President of the Republic under the new laws or decrees, which make interventions and violations such as those enacted at Bogazici University possible, without any proper justification or dialogue with the university bodies before taking action in such critical matters as appointments or the creation …

New President of Bilim Akademisi

Bilim Akademisi General Assembly (GA) that had been postponed three times due to the COVID-19 pandemic for the last 18 months, was finally held on June 17, 2021.  Bilim Akademisi founding president Prof. Dr. Ali Alpar handed over the task to our new president, Prof. Dr. Canan Atılgan who was elected during the GA.

Prof. Atılgan has been a member of Bilim Akademisi since 2012. Her research interests are polymer and protein dynamics, theoretical and computational investigation of complex molecular systems. (http://people.sabanciuniv.edu/canan/)

Zeynep Çelik among SAH Fellows

Science Academy Turkey – Bilim Akademisi member Zeynep Çelik is recognized  as a Fellow of Society of Architectural Historians.

The Board of Directors names as Fellows of the Society of Architectural Historians individuals who have distinguished themselves by a lifetime of significant contributions to the field. These contributions may include scholarship, service to the Society, teaching and stewardship of the built environment.

Engin Umut Akkaya receives the TWAS award in Chemistry

Science Academy, Turkey – Bilim Akademisi  member Prof. Dr. Engin Umut Akkaya receives the TWAS award in Chemistry.
Prof.Akkaya, who is currently a member of faculty in the Dalian University of Technology in China, received the award for “his fundamental contribution to the understanding of how inherent limitations of photodynamic therapy can be overcome” .

Metin Sitti awarded the «Breakthrough of the Year» Award at the Fallings Walls World Science Summi

The Science Academy, Bilim Akademisi  member and Koç University faculty member Professor Metin Sitti receives the «Breakthrough of the Year» Award in the Engineering and Technology category at the Fallings Walls World Science Summit in Berlin for his researches on wireless miniature medical robots, gecko-inspired microfiber adhesives, bio-inspired miniature robots, and physical intelligence. Mete Atatüre awarded the 2020 Thomas Young Medal and Prize

The Science Academy, Bilim Akademisi  member and Cambridge University faculty member Professor Mete Atatüre has won the 2020 Thomas Young Medal and Prize for his pioneering contributions to quantum optical phenomena in semiconductors and diamond, creating ‘exciting applications’ in quantum technologies.
